The Core of Kenshin’s Ideals

To truly understand the impact Kenshin has on Danes Leaf, we must first delve into the character himself. Kenshin Himura, the wandering swordsman, is not defined by his past alone, but by his transformation. He is a man haunted by the blood he shed in his past life as a legendary assassin known as “Battosai the Manslayer”. Yet, he has chosen to forsake his former life of violence and become a protector, a champion of the weak and the oppressed. His red hair, the crossed scar on his cheek, and the reversed-blade sword he carries are iconic symbols of this transformation.

Kenshin’s core principles are rooted in compassion, justice, and a dedication to non-violence. This unwavering commitment to a peaceful life, despite his past, is a testament to his inner strength and his determination to atone for his past sins. He is a character who values life above all else, using his incredible swordsmanship not to kill, but to protect. His actions, born from a place of profound remorse and a desire for redemption, resonate deeply with those who have suffered and those striving for a better world.
